咨询:13913979388
+ 微信号:13913979388

当前位置首页 >> 硬盘

gaussdb介绍,gaussdb数据库官网

深入解析华为云GaussDB:下一代数据库的智能与高效随着数字化转型的加速,企业对于数据库的需求日益增长,不仅要求数据库具备强大的数据处理能力,还要求其具备高度的智能化和安全性。华为云GaussDB作为一款高性能、智能化的数据库产品,应运而生,为用户提供了一种全新的数据库解决方案。一、GaussDB概述华为云GaussDB是一

内容介绍 / introduce


深入解析华为云GaussDB:下一代数据库的智能与高效

gaussdb介绍

随着数字化转型的加速,企业对于数据库的需求日益增长,不仅要求数据库具备强大的数据处理能力,还要求其具备高度的智能化和安全性。华为云GaussDB作为一款高性能、智能化的数据库产品,应运而生,为用户提供了一种全新的数据库解决方案。

一、GaussDB概述

gaussdb介绍

华为云GaussDB是一款基于云原生架构的分布式数据库,支持多种数据类型,包括关系型数据、非关系型数据以及时序数据等。GaussDB旨在提供高性能、高可用、高可靠、易扩展的数据库服务,满足企业级应用的需求。

二、GaussDB的核心技术

gaussdb介绍

1. 逻辑解码技术

华为云GaussDB采用了先进的逻辑解码技术,能够将数据库的WAL(Wrie-Ahead Loggig)日志转换为易于理解和处理的逻辑日志格式,如JSO、二进制或文本格式。这种技术使得数据同步更加高效,尤其是在异构数据库之间进行数据迁移和同步时,能够确保数据的一致性和准确性。

2. 并行解码

为了进一步提升解码性能,GaussDB支持并行解码。通过多线程并发执行,包括Reader线程、Decoder线程和Seder线程,并行解码能够显著提高解码速率,最高可达100MB/s。这种高效的处理方式,使得GaussDB在处理大规模数据时,依然能够保持出色的性能。

3. DDL解码和多版本数据字典

GaussDB支持DDL解码,将DDL SQL解析为Jso格式并记录在WAL日志中。逻辑解码线程会解析这些Jso字符串并输出DDL的逻辑日志,从而实现数据定义语言的操作同步。

此外,GaussDB还提供了多版本数据字典,允许用户在不影响数据库性能的前提下进行指定位点解码,这对于数据恢复和故障排除具有重要意义。

4. 分布式解码

为了处理整个集群的增量数据,GaussDB支持分布式解码,包括直连D解码和C解码。这种分布式解码能力,使得GaussDB能够更好地适应大规模分布式数据库环境。

三、GaussDB的安全特性

gaussdb介绍

1. 密态等值查询

华为云GaussDB采用了密态等值查询技术,通过客户端的加解密模块和密钥管理模块,使用AES128和AES256加密算法,对查询涉及的加密列进行加密,服务器端则进行密文下的查询处理,支持等值计算,从而确保数据的安全性。

2. 账本数据库

账本数据库是GaussDB的另一个安全关键技术方案,通过增加校验信息、使用高效篡改校验算法和内置共识算法,确保数据的防篡改和可追溯性。该方案通过创建特殊的防篡改用户表和对应的用户历史表、全局区块表来进行数据记录和校验。

四、

gaussdb介绍

华为云GaussDB凭借其高性能、智能化、安全可靠的特点,成为了下一代数据库的佼佼者。随着数字化转型的不断深入,GaussDB有望成为企业数据库的首选,助力企业实现数据驱动业务增长。